Browse Source
Merge pull request #12772 from irynamatveieva/calculated-fields
Calculated fields:removed resource
pull/12791/head
Andrew Shvayka
1 year ago
committed by
GitHub
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
2 changed files with
1 additions and
4 deletions
-
application/src/main/java/org/thingsboard/server/service/security/permission/Resource.java
-
application/src/main/java/org/thingsboard/server/service/security/permission/TenantAdminPermissions.java
|
|
|
@ -50,9 +50,7 @@ public enum Resource { |
|
|
|
VERSION_CONTROL, |
|
|
|
NOTIFICATION(EntityType.NOTIFICATION_TARGET, EntityType.NOTIFICATION_TEMPLATE, |
|
|
|
EntityType.NOTIFICATION_REQUEST, EntityType.NOTIFICATION_RULE), |
|
|
|
MOBILE_APP_SETTINGS, |
|
|
|
CALCULATED_FIELD(EntityType.CALCULATED_FIELD), |
|
|
|
CALCULATED_FIELD_LINK(EntityType.CALCULATED_FIELD_LINK); |
|
|
|
MOBILE_APP_SETTINGS; |
|
|
|
|
|
|
|
private final Set<EntityType> entityTypes; |
|
|
|
|
|
|
|
|
|
|
|
@ -55,7 +55,6 @@ public class TenantAdminPermissions extends AbstractPermissions { |
|
|
|
put(Resource.OAUTH2_CONFIGURATION_TEMPLATE, new PermissionChecker.GenericPermissionChecker(Operation.READ)); |
|
|
|
put(Resource.MOBILE_APP, tenantEntityPermissionChecker); |
|
|
|
put(Resource.MOBILE_APP_BUNDLE, tenantEntityPermissionChecker); |
|
|
|
put(Resource.CALCULATED_FIELD, tenantEntityPermissionChecker); |
|
|
|
} |
|
|
|
|
|
|
|
public static final PermissionChecker tenantEntityPermissionChecker = new PermissionChecker() { |
|
|
|
|